Tips for Utilizing Character Names Effectively
Choosing and employing character names strategically enhances narrative impact and audience engagement. Careful consideration of a name’s connotations, construction, and context can significantly contribute to a project’s success.
Tip 1: Target Audience: Align name selection with the target demographic. A children’s book character requires a different naming approach than a character in a gritty crime thriller.
Tip 2: Memorability: Strive for names that are easy to remember and pronounce. Avoid overly complex or similar-sounding names that might confuse the audience.
Tip 3: Connotation: Consider the implied meanings and associations a name evokes. A name can subtly communicate aspects of a character’s personality, background, or role.
Tip 4: Originality vs. Familiarity: Strike a balance between creating unique names and leveraging the familiarity of established names. An unusual name can be intriguing, but an overly eccentric name might distract.
Tip 5: Consistency: Maintain consistent naming conventions throughout a project. Avoid sudden shifts in style or tone that disrupt the established narrative flow.
Tip 6: Cultural Sensitivity: Research the cultural origins and implications of names to avoid unintentional offense or misrepresentation.
Tip 7: Testing and Feedback: Solicit feedback on potential names from target audience members to gauge their effectiveness and identify potential issues.
Effective character naming contributes to a more immersive and engaging experience for the audience. By considering these factors, one can maximize the impact and memorability of fictional or representative entities.
